Overview of Sunrise of Naperville

Conveniently situated just moments away from downtown Naperville, Sunrise of Naperville presents a charming haven that seamlessly blends with the local landscape. This award-winning establishment caters to diverse needs, offering a holistic approach that includes assisted living for seniors and memory care services. The exterior exudes an air of sophistication, graced with meticulously maintained surroundings and an inviting fire pit, setting the stage for an exceptional living experience.

Embracing the unique needs of its residents, the community extends a pet-friendly environment and showcases inviting social areas, creating an atmosphere of warmth and engagement. Alongside services like housekeeping, personal laundry, and scheduled transportation, Sunrise of Naperville takes pride in its commitment to offering assisted living homes.

Inspection History

In Illinois, the Department of Public Health, Office of Health Care Regulation conducts annual unannounced surveys to assess compliance with state and federal healthcare facility standards.

9 visits/inspections

2 visits/inspections triggered by complaints

2 other visits

Breakdown by inspection type
  • 3 licensing inspections
  • 2 complaint investigations
  • 2 incident investigations
  • 2 other inspections

Latest inspection

Date:November 18, 2025
